At anchor outside Jolly Harbour. Up early for Dave Mc to outboard over to improve Mike Clear’s morale (bad engine problems) on Irish Oyster 51  ‘Oysterhaven’.
Get away late morning for a bouncy trip downwind, with seas all over the place. Got in to Nevis late and pick up a mooring off a strange dark beach. We have no flags to honour our new hosts and we haven’t cleared immigration. Recommendation is to go ashore to Sunshine Beach Cafe, wherever it is. Dodgy call. Rolling around at our (illegal) mooring. Tired. Get dinghy up and in water and engine in.  Cant find dinghy keys. Cant find outboard switch so MB decides to make one. Ass over tit scenario getting into dinghy with big swell. Pitch blackness. Where to go ashore? What if we find a windswept concrete pier with barbed wire or a shelving beach with a surfbreak, glass bottles, tree roots and dog turds?  We do find a big pier so we lock up to it. Man in immaculate whites comes to tell us to buzz off. Dave falls into dinghy and cuts foot. Blood everywhere. Motor to beach and carry dinghy beyond shorebreak. Sunshine beach cafe is great so MB has spare ribs (muskrat, moose, or marmoset though...not sure). David Mc has lobster. Chips all round. Good meal.
Some difficulty relocating dinghy...and boat but get away with it and return on board very knackered.
